Handover: Kiosk watchdog (Perchlight)

Hey plugin folks — I'm handing the Perchlight watchdog over to Dara, but here's what you need to know. The watchdog restarts the kiosk shell if your plugin blocks the render loop for more than four seconds, so keep heavy work off the main thread or you'll get restart-looped. It also writes a crash breadcrumb you can read on next boot. Thresholds, breadcrumb format, and the exemption process are all documented here:

wiki page, fajof-tajef: https://vault.tolvaqio.corp/board/pipeline/pages/ticket/c20d7f984bcc9e12

**CI note: timezone weirdness in report exports**

Heads up, support folks — if a customer says their Ledgerpine export shows times shifted by a few hours, it's probably the CI image. The export workers got rebuilt last week and the base image defaults to UTC, while older workers used the account's locale. Fix is rolling out; meanwhile tell customers the data itself is fine, just the display offset. Affected exports carry the build token shown below.

build token for bajof-tahop: htk4_a981

## Step 2: Encoding Detection

Swap the Byrewell sniffer for the new Glyphsort detector on all upload paths. Glyphsort handles BOM-less UTF-16 and legacy Pelthic codepages the old library mangled. Remove the charset override query param; it is ignored now. Detection stats are written per-upload for audit, so point the stats writer at the metrics store using the connection string below.

replica DSN, yawif-hafog: redis://oliiel_svc:5a@db-d061.paliqlabs.corp:5432/tamion

**Vendor note: Inkmill markdown pipeline**

Rendering for Parchway docs is outsourced to Inkmill under an annual contract, renewing each March. They handle sanitization and PDF export; we own the upload queue. SLA: 4-hour response on rendering failures. Escalate only after two failed retries. Their support desk is reachable at the address below.

billing contact of hahaf-baguf = zorael.tammir.jorius@sivrelhq.internal